    The only reprints that wouldn't be counterfeit would be printed by OPC. OPC did two prints of the card in 79/80. The first print has the two thin blue lines along the length of the back of card. Both are considered true Rookie Cards but some collectors will pay a premium for the 1st print. Besides the 25th anniversary OPC printed in the early 90s, that is clearly marked on the front of the cards, I don't know of any other prints done by OPC.
